6Grimm
A Detective Must Protect And Serve Against Inhuman Dangers
Based on theBrothers Grimm Fairy Tales,Grimmoffers a new and modern take on these classic stories of yore. The main character, Nick Burkhardt, is a homicide detective in Portland, whose otherwise ordinary job involves taking on dangerous creatures from mythology known as Wesen. Descended from a line of hunters known as the Grimms, his solemn duty is to protect the innocent against evil.
Throughout the show, Nick faces off against increasingly dire threats with the help of his partner, Hank Griffin, and a friendly Wesen by the name of Monroe, who has no interest in helping his monstrous brethren. Having a detective as the main character adds a noir element to the series, and offers a completely different take on classic fairy tales. Fans of mystery and fantasy are in for a treat withGrimm.

3Merlin
A Monster Hunting Show With A Fantasy Twist
The BBC network is known in Britain for more than just news, having created some truly fantastic original shows, such asDoctor Who,The Musketeers, andMerlin.Based on the mythologysurrounding the kingdom of Camelot and King Arthur,Merlinrevolves around the titular sorcerer who finds himself as King Arthur’s servant, saddled with the onerous destiny of saving his life, which he will do time and time again.
Episode after episode, Merlin, Arthur, and the kingdom will be challenged by a new and dangerous threat, mostly creatures conjured or created by magic-wielding evil sorcerers who wish to undo the Pendragon line for one reason or another. The most famous antagonist is the legendary Morgana, who acts as Merlin and Camelot’s biggest threat. Creating a fantasy monster hunter story results in a unique monster-hunting show that is suitable for the whole family.
2Angel
A Demon-Hunting Vampire
Angel was one of the core characters ofBuffy the Vampire Slayer, a vampire cursed to lose his soul and devolve into his evil alter-ego Angelus whenever he experienced a moment of true happiness as recompense for his diabolical deeds. He departedBuffyat the end of season 3, seeking his redemption in the dark, demon-infested city of Los Angeles. It is here he founded Angel Investigations to help those facing supernatural threats big and small.
Fashioned asa monster-of-the-week show, fans ofBuffywill be happy to see more monster ass-kicking featuring familiar faces such as Wesley, Cordelia, Spike, Darla, and Willow, with the former two as members of the core group inBuffy.Angelunfortunately met a premature end leaving unanswered questions and an unresolved fight for survival, but it still remains an enjoyable show with a darker overtone that monster-hunting fans are sure to love.
